WebThe Windows Snipping Tool captures all or part of your PC screen. After you capture a snip, it's automatically copied to the Snipping Tool window. From there you can edit, save, or share the snip. Press Windows logo key+Shift+S. The desktop will darken while you select an area for your screenshot. Rectangular mode is the default capture option. WebDec 30, 2024 · tracert -h 3 lifewire.com > z:\tracertresults.txt. In this last example of the tracert command in Windows, we're using -h to limit the hop count to 3, but instead of displaying the results in Command Prompt, we'll use the > redirection operator to send it all to a TXT file located on Z:, an external hard drive.
